Publicado en: Oct 4, 2023

Hoy anunciamos la disponibilidad general de la compatibilidad con la extensión de enlace de Amazon Simple Queue Service (Amazon SQS) en el proyecto de código abierto CoreWCF. A medida que moderniza sus aplicaciones orientadas a servicios basadas en Windows Communications Foundation (WCF) mediante enlaces MSMQ con CoreWCF multiplataforma, ahora puede utilizar Amazon SQS como uno de los enlaces. 

Los enlaces CoreWCF deciden cómo debe comunicarse el punto de conexión del servicio con los clientes. Como parte de esta contribución de código abierto, publicamos dos paquetes NuGet, las extensiones CoreWCF de AWS (del lado del servidor) y las extensiones WCF de AWS (del lado del cliente). Con los enlaces de transporte de Amazon SQS Queue, los clientes pueden enviar mensajes SOAP a Amazon SQS a través del cliente WCF y ejecutar los servicios de CoreWCF para recibir y procesar esos mensajes sin cambiar ningún contrato o implementación de servicio. Además, este transporte ofrece la posibilidad de adjuntar métodos de devolución de llamada que pueden activar acciones adicionales, como las notificaciones de Amazon Simple Notification Service (Amazon SNS) y las invocaciones de AWS Lambda una vez procesado un mensaje. 

Para obtener más información y empezar, visite el repositorio de GitHub y la publicación del blog.